Will a parking ticket raise insurance rates?

Generally parking violation will not effect your insurance. These are not considered moving violations and thererfore will not increase the premiums.

What can trigger an increase in a driver's insurance rates?

There are a number of different factors that insurance companies look at. The biggest ones are if you had a claim for an accident recently or if you received any moving violations (parking tickets don't count). If these don't apply, call your insurance company and ask why your rates went up, they may have had a bad year and raised everyone's rates to offset last years losses.

What type of traffic violations affect car insurance rates?

Speeding and the amount you were going over the limit can affect your car insurance rates. Some companies won't penalize you for getting a ticket if you have a clean record and some companies penalize for some tickets but not others. The best solution is to ask your specific company what violations affect their rates.


Photo tickets increase auto insurance?

Photo tickets are considered a moving violation. Moving violations will increase your auto insurance premiums if you are found guilty. When you pay the fine associated with your photo ticket, you are admitting guilt. If you go to court and fight the ticket, you can request traffic school. Going to traffic school or fighting the ticket are the only two ways to prevent an increase in your insurance rates.
